## Timetable solver: tighten backtracking

Swaps the naive depth-first search in Chalkline's solver for conflict-directed backjumping. Cuts solve time on the Merrowfield sample set by roughly 60%. No API changes; existing fixtures pass. New folks: read solver/README first. Tuning knobs moved into one place, shown below.

constants for bawif-kawif:
QUOTAS = {
    "ulaael": 5,
    "holael": 10,
}

Handover: Image slimming for Corvid-API

Hey Matteo — picking this up where I left off. I moved the build to a multi-stage Dockerfile, swapped the base for our minimal Frostline image, and stripped dev dependencies plus the locale packs nobody used. Image went from 1.4 GB to 210 MB. Watch out: the healthcheck binary needs libssl, so don't trim that layer. CI is green. The build args and runtime settings the slim image now expects are listed below.

settings of fafog-haduf:
ZORIX_PIN=4648
ZORIX_METRICS_HOST=metrics.zorix.paliqsys.corp
ZORIX_LOG_LEVEL=info
ZORIX_TENANT=druix

Subject: Reseller Programme — Board Preview

Dear executive team,

Ahead of the board session, here is the status of the Corvane reseller programme. Twelve partners are now certified, margins are holding at target, and channel conflict complaints have dropped since the territory rules were clarified. Onboarding costs remain above plan and we are addressing that in the next cohort. The strategic intent driving the expansion is set out in the note below.

internal memo for tajof-kaduf: Only 65 of the 511 pilot accounts renewed Lamdor, so a churn review is set for January 26. Aldmirek Works is in early talks to buy Alddorox Works for about $490.9 million.

### Step 4 — Dual-write phase

Before flipping the Quillbase migrator to dual-write mode, make sure the shadow table finished backfilling (check the progress gauge, not the logs — the logs lie). If you're on call and this step stalls, it's almost always the write-lock timeout being too aggressive. Don't hand-edit anything in prod; adjust via the deploy pipeline. The migrator's settings for this phase are shown below.

service settings:
WENATH_PIN=5007
WENATH_METRICS_HOST=metrics.wenath.tolvaqlabs.corp
WENATH_LOG_LEVEL=debug
WENATH_TENANT=rusox